|
@@ -49,6 +49,7 @@ export default {
|
|
|
tablecols2: [],
|
|
|
classList1: [],
|
|
|
classList2: [],
|
|
|
+ optionIndex: 0
|
|
|
}
|
|
|
},
|
|
|
created() {
|
|
@@ -57,8 +58,9 @@ export default {
|
|
|
this.selectList();
|
|
|
},
|
|
|
methods: {
|
|
|
- rowClick({ children }) {
|
|
|
- this.classList2 = children;
|
|
|
+ rowClick(data) {
|
|
|
+ this.classList2 = data.children;
|
|
|
+ this.optionIndex = data.index;
|
|
|
},
|
|
|
changeData(e) {
|
|
|
console.log(e)
|
|
@@ -73,7 +75,8 @@ export default {
|
|
|
}).then(res => {
|
|
|
console.log("分类", res)
|
|
|
this.classList1 = res.data;
|
|
|
- if (res.data.length > 0) this.classList2 = res.data[0].children;
|
|
|
+ this.classList2 = res.data[this.optionIndex].children;
|
|
|
+ console.log(this.classList2)
|
|
|
})
|
|
|
}
|
|
|
}
|
|
@@ -89,6 +92,5 @@ export default {
|
|
|
.classname {
|
|
|
flex: 1;
|
|
|
background: #fff;
|
|
|
- padding: 0 16px;
|
|
|
}
|
|
|
</style>
|